What the report says

Wired reports that Starling, a two-person sound design startup led by Joel Corelitz and Colin Coogan, has been experimenting with a way to make microwave alerts less abrasive without requiring manufacturers to add new parts. The idea targets a familiar irritation in kitchens: the sharp, repetitive beep produced by many microwave ovens when cooking ends or buttons are pressed.

According to Wired, Starling’s approach uses the existing microcontroller and passive piezoelectric buzzer already found in most microwaves. Instead of changing hardware, the designers alter the code that drives the buzzer, producing short trills, frequency sweeps, arpeggios and softer button-feedback sounds. Corelitz demonstrated the concept using software the pair built, called Microwave Sound Bench, along with a simple Arduino-based test setup connected to piezo buzzers.

The article explains why the problem has persisted: piezo buzzers are extremely cheap, simple and widely used across consumer electronics, while full speakers would add cost in a competitive appliance market. Starling argues that manufacturers could improve the user experience largely through programming choices, though adoption would depend on appliance makers being willing to update device code.

Wired also cites Richard Hughes, a former Whirlpool user-experience designer and now a Volvo digital design lead, who said many appliance companies have limited in-house sound design expertise and often carry over old behavior specifications across products. The broader significance is that small audio details may become a product differentiator, especially as brands look for low-cost ways to make everyday devices feel less annoying and more polished.
